I wrote the first episode of Moonlighting after the pilot so, as they say, I was there in the beginning before I went off to write a couple miniseries and a bunch of movies for television.
If I may reminisce…
While the pilot he wrote was filming, Glenn Gordon Caron, the creator of the series, hauled me into his office I suspect it was because I was the only unemployed writer at the time he could find. We were acquainted through mutual friends before this.
I was a bit jealous and could not understand why he was writing pilots which did not get picked up for series going forward and would end up being no more than two-hour TV Movies and he was getting paid four times what I was for writing TV movies. But then I got to read his pilot script for Moonlighting itself. It was a revelation, a dazzling piece of film writing. It was fifty pages too long but raced along like no script I’d read before for either television or feature films, like no script I’ve read since, and came right on time.
